Prescribed burn planned for northeast Edmonton park to mitigate wildfire risk

In a news release issued Tuesday, the City of Edmonton said a prescribed burn will take place sometime mid-morning Wednesday as long as weather conditions are favourable to do so.



The City of Edmonton will conduct a prescribed burn in Northeast River Valley Park on Wednesday to mitigate wildfire risk. The park will be closed for the day, and smoke may be visible. The burn aims to reduce wildfire fuel, prevent high-intensity fires, recycle nutrients, and increase biodiversity. This is part of the city’s proactive wildfire prevention efforts.
